Base catalysed aldol condensation occurs with:

A

Propanaldehyde

B

Benzaldehyde

C

2-Methyl propanaldehyde

D

2,2-Dimethyl propanaldehyde

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A

Compounds containing `alpha`-H atom undergo Aldol condensation.
